Ingredients List

For the Lazy Day Taco Soup in Slow Cooker, gather the following ingredients:
- 1 lb ground beef or turkey (or a plant-based alternative for a vegetarian option)
- 1 can (15 oz) black beans, rinsed and drained
- 1 can (15 oz) corn, drained (try using frozen corn for a fresher taste)
- 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es (fire-roasted for extra flavor!)
- 1 packet taco seasoning (homemade blends work wonders too!)
- 1 cup low-sodium chicken or vegetable broth
- 1 bell pepper, diced (choose your favorite color)
- 1 small onion, chopped
- 1 cup shredded cheese (optional, but highly recommended!)
- Toppings: Sour cream, avocado, cilantro, or tortilla chips
Feel free to get creative with substitutions based on dietary preferences or what’s available in your pantry!

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Brown the meat
In a skillet over medium heat, brown your ground beef or turkey until cooked through. Drain the excess fat for a healthier option.
Step 2: Combine ingredients
Add the browned meat along with black beans, corn, diced tomatoes, taco seasoning, bell pepper, onion, and broth to the slow cooker. Stir well to combine all flavors.
Step 3: Slow cook
Set your slow cooker to low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ours. Enjoy the aromas filling your home as it cooks!
Step 4: Serve and garnish
Once cooked, ladle the soup into bowls and sprinkle with shredded cheese and your favorite toppings.

Lazy Day Taco Soup in Slow Cooker
- Total Time: 6 hours 10 minutes
- Yield: 6 servings 1x
Description
Lazy Day Taco Soup in the slow cooker is the perfect dump-and-go meal for busy nights. Packed with seasoned ground beef, beans, corn, tomatoes, and flavorful spices, this hearty soup cooks itself while you go about your day. A family favorite that’s warm, cozy, and ready when you are!
Ingredients
- 1 lb ground beef (or ground turkey)
- 1 small onion, diced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 packet taco seasoning
- 1 packet ranch dressing mix
- 1 can (15 oz) black beans, drained and rinsed
- 1 can (15 oz) kidney beans, drained and rinsed
- 1 can (15 oz) corn, drained
- 1 can (10 oz) Rotel (tomatoes with green chilies)
- 1 can (15 oz) diced tomatoes
- 3 cups beef broth (or chicken broth)
- Optional toppings: shredded cheese, sour cream, avocado, tortilla chips, cilantro
Instructions
- In a skillet, brown the ground beef with onion until fully cooked. Drain excess fat.
- Transfer beef mixture to your slow cooker.
- Add garlic, taco seasoning, ranch mix, beans, corn, Rotel, diced tomatoes, and broth.
- Stir well to combine.
- Cover and cook on LOW for 6–8 hours or on HIGH for 3–4 hours.
- Serve hot with your favorite toppings like cheese, sour cream, or tortilla chips.
Notes
This soup freezes beautifully and tastes even better the next day. For a creamier version, stir in 4 oz cream cheese during the last 30 minutes of cooking.

FAQs
Can I make this soup vegetarian?
Absolutely! Substitute the meat with lentils or additional beans, and use vegetable broth instead.
How can I make this soup spicier?
Add diced jalapeños or a dash of cayenne pepper for that extra kick!
Can I use canned vegetables instead of fresh?
Yes, canned vegetables work well, saving you time without sacrificing flavor.
How do I thicken the soup?
If you prefer a thicker consistency, consider adding cornstarch mixed with cold water or a small amount of mashed beans.
